The Purpose of the Initial Examination is to Answer these Questions:
- What sort of problem is present, if any?
- When is the proper time to begin treatment?
- What type of treatment is indicated?
- How long will treatment take?
- How much will the treatment cost?
What’s Next?
If orthodontic treatment is needed at the time of the initial exam, an appointment for Diagnostic Records is scheduled. If time allows, these diagnostic records can be taken at the initial visit.
What are Diagnostic Records?
- Digital models of your teeth.
- Photographs of your face and teeth.
- Panoramic and cephalogram radiographs.
- Dr. Monica Ginart will study the diagnostic records and determine the best course of treatment.

What Does my Investment Include?
Your investment includes:
- Orthodontic records, which consist of x-rays, photographs, digital models, and a personalized growth study workup to determine your treatment objectives.
- Active treatment fee for both early treatment options and complete comprehensive treatment with braces or clear aligners including all appliances, office visits, and procedures performed in the office. Appliances are durable and should last through the entire treatment period if the patient follows instructions. If appliances require replacement due to loss, breakage, misuse, or failure to eliminate foods that cause damage, we reserve the right to charge an additional replacement fee.
- One set of final retainers for our comprehensive (Phase II) patients is provided upon completion of treatment. There is a replacement fee for each additional retainer that is lost or broken.
What Doesn’t my Investment Include?
- Work performed at other dental offices outside our orthodontic practice.
- If an accident or injury occurs during treatment that results in TMJ (Temporo-Mandibular-Joint, or your jaw) complications, additional orthodontics, orthognathic surgery, etc, a fee adjustment may be required to complete treatment under these unusual circumstances.

How do I know if I need braces or clear aligners?
Common signs include crowded teeth, gaps, difficulty biting or chewing, jaw discomfort, or teeth that don’t align properly. During your consultation, Dr. Monica Ginart will explain whether braces, clear aligners, or another treatment option is best for your smile goals and lifestyle.

Will I need to wear retainers after treatment?
Yes. Retainers are an important part of maintaining your new smile after braces or aligners. One set of final retainers is included for comprehensive treatment patients, and we’ll provide instructions on how to wear and care for them properly.
